Police Officer Samuel Briggs has moved from New Mexico to
Stratton, PA to start a new life after a tragic loss. He
patrols the town on his new third-shift beat and spends his
off-time fixing-up his new home. The people he meets are
warm and welcoming and he makes it a habit to stop by
Dixie's Cup diner for dinner and coffee. He has a hard time
admitting to himself that he's also draw to Dixie's by Rey,
the handsome short-order cook who makes a mean special.
Samuel wants to start over but isn't sure that he's ready
for a relationship. When an offer of lunch turns into to an
afternoon of "just sex" Samuel finds himself caring about
Rey as a friend with the potential for more. Samuel knows Rey
is dealing with burdens of his own but doesn't know how to
help a man whose pride leads him to take care of himself.
Cooking is just one of Rey King's many jobs. He's buried
under the weight of debt, hurt, and disappointment. He has
little time for anything other than work and isn't
interested in a relationship when he feels he has nothing
left to give. But, he can't seem to stop thinking of Samuel
and that's who he finds himself turning to when he is
overwhelmed. Together, Samuel and Rey will find unexpected
healing and love.
In COST OF REPAIRS, A. M. Arthur weaves an emotionally
complex story that captures the imagination. The novel is
structured in 3 parts; the story is told from Samuel's point
of view, then Rey's, then both. The format gives additional
power to the story in that the wounds and life experience
that motivate each man are gradually unveiled to the reader.
We know Rey is struggling but we don't know why until we
sift to his perspective. The curiosity and uncertainty kept
me reading late into the night. Ms. Arthur created
extremely vivid characters and I wasn't going to be
satisfied until they had their happy ending. The story has
an erotic element but I felt it was secondary to the power
of the emotional relationship elements. I absolutely look
forward to reading more by Ms. Arthur.
Fixing the home can heal the heart—if you can find all the pieces. Police officer Samuel Briggs is getting to know the people on his new, third-shift beat, but he’d prefer they not know too much about him—or the painful past that drove him away from New Mexico to start fresh in small-town Stratton, PA. All he wants is peace, a manageable routine, and time to fix up his project home. There’s no room in his broken heart for a new relationship. It’s crowded with too many memories. But there’s something about the Dixie’s Cup short-order cook, who’s flirty one minute, distracted the next, that piques Sam’s interest. Part-time cook, part-time hardware salesman and full-time handyman Rey King lives to work—but not because he loves it. Relationships? No time. Until one glance at Sam’s haunted eyes sends a plumb line straight to his wary heart. One afternoon of impulsive, no-strings sex begins to grow into a cautious friendship. But when Rey is seriously injured protecting a friend, the cracks in their already shaky foundation begin to show. Falling in love wasn’t in either man’s recovery plan…and this time, the risk could be too great.
